Which is cheaper, Arizona College of Nursing-Tampa or Cape Coral Technical College?

Cape Coral Technical College, at $1,463 a year after aid versus $36,680 — a gap of $35,217 a year, or $140,868 across the full degree. These are net prices after grants and scholarships, not sticker prices, so they reflect what an aided student pays.

Do Arizona College of Nursing-Tampa or Cape Coral Technical College graduates earn more?

Cape Coral Technical College graduates report a median $36,080 ten years after entry, $1,423 more than the $34,657 at Arizona College of Nursing-Tampa. Both are institution-wide medians from federal tax records, so a high-paying major at the lower school can beat the average at the higher one.
